Yolanda survivors receive property titles

Miriam Desacada - The Philippine Star

TACLOBAN CITY , Philippines — Over P1,000 families who survived the devastation from Super Typhoon Yolanda have received titles for the property they are occupying at two relocation sites in this city.

The distribution of land titles for the beneficiaries of the Yolanda Pabahay Program was held on July 8 and 9 at the North Hill Arbours 1 and 2 located in Barangay 105 San Isidro.

The program was led by Mayor Alfred Romualdez and the city councilors, particularly Aimee Grafil who chairs the urban poor housing and resettlement committee, as well as officials of the National Housing Authority (NHA) in Eastern Visayas.

Romualdez said it has been his commitment to provide Yolanda survivors with land and housing units that they can call their own.

The land titles will be notarized for free at the Tacloban City Hall-north extension starting tomorrow, the city government said.

NHA-Eastern Visayas manager Constancio Enteniero thanked the city officials for supporting the housing program of the government.

Thousands of housing units are also set for distribution to other beneficiaries in the second half of the year, Enteniero said.

Distribution of more property titles will resume on July 21 for beneficiaries at other resettlement sites that will be identified by the NHA and the city housing and community development office.

Romualdez assured the beneficiaries that they would be comfortable in their communities.
